Cate Adams

Cate is based in the Kirk of St Nicholas, but serves the whole city centre, with her main focus being the retail sector. She is part of Scottish Churches Industrial Mission which is a group of men and women, paid and voluntary, ordained and lay people, who feel called to a challenging ministry in the workplace.

The chaplains visit work places to speak with, listen to and affirm people at all levels, of all faiths and none, seeking to relate the Gospel and bring Christian values to relationships, methods of work and work – life situations

Lonely, angry, sad, hurt or just need someone to talk to. Why not get in touch? I offer a friendly ear to listen to you in total confidence. You don’t have to belong to any particular church, or believe in God to talk to me. You may be of any faith or culture or just plain curious.

I try to pop in to most of the shops in the Bon Accord – St Nicholas Centre every month or so but if you want some privacy give me a ring and we can meet anywhere you feel comfortable with.
